The acquire bandwidth e.g. of Yb:KGW and Yb:KYW may be very big in comparison with that of Yb:YAG. This permits for wide wavelength tunability and for Significantly shorter pulse durations from method-locked lasers. Values very well underneath a hundred fs happen to be attained with passive method locking.

Tungstates have a tendency to own superior Raman coefficients (�?Raman scattering). Therefore, they're able to make major Raman attain at average optical intensities. It is achievable to make use of get more info the laser crystal by itself like a Raman converter.

The polarized absorption spectra of Tm3+-doped potassium yttrium tungstate (Tm:KY(WO4)2) crystal at area temperature were being measured. The emission spectrum and lifetime in the three File four psyched state had been established. Employing common and modified Judd–Ofelt theories, the depth parameters as well as radiative lifetimes were calculated and good agreement With all the experimental outcomes was acquired for both theories.
